Rugby trophy is star of show

The RBS 6 Nations 2012 Trophy Tour is to visit Musselburgh on Thursday February 9, where the official tournament trophy will be on display to fans at the local RBS branch on Bridge Street, before calling in at Musselburgh RFC.

Those wanting their photo taken with the prestigious trophy are asked to visit the RBS Musselburgh branch between 12-3pm or go to the rugby club from 6pm onwards.

At the club, members of the local community and rugby fans can not only get their hands on the trophy but are also invited to take part in a Q&A session with Scottish rugby legend Andy Nicol, who planns to share his unique experiences from playing rugby at the highest level of the game.

The RBS Trophy Tour aims to reward rugby clubs which have been performing well in their respective leagues as well as recognise the work they do in their local communities and to support the game at club level.

The RBS Trophy Tour will be visiting five other rugby clubs including Preston Lodge, Prestonpans, on February 22.
